Rest Assured by Vicki Courtney – Book Review
Are you the type of person who tends to do more than they should?
Are you a multi-tasker? Someone who always has several projects on their plate? A woman who’s juggling several roles at once?
Do you always feel exhausted, rarely have time for yourself, have trouble winding down for sleep because the events of the day or the things you couldn’t complete on your over-stuffed to-do list are still running through your head?
If so, then Vicki Courtney’s Rest Assured – A Recovery Plan For Weary Souls was written specifically for you!
Rest Assured is written for women who feel that their “greatest risk” is “slowing down and resting” – for women who have “forgotten how to be still”. It’s a book that draws inspiration from Scripture – a book that helps us find the “rest for our souls” that Jesus promised in Matthew 11:29.
Rest Assured takes us on a 30-day journey and recovery plan that challenges us to de-emphasize our culturally-conditioned need to be busy during every waking hour and instead, to start focusing on the biblical imperative to rest.
For those of us who are drowning in a sea of must-dos and should-dos, this book is a lifesaver, I found the book practical and encouraging – filled with plenty of inspiration, exercises and easy-to-implement ideas to help us simplify our lives.
Vicki writes:
My prayer is that this book will produce in each of us an awareness so that when we find ourselves scrambling down the same weary path once again (and trust me, it’s only a matter of time), we can catch ourselves. The truth is, most of us will spend our entire lives learning to be still. My hope is that once we’ve tasted the benefits of being still, we won’t tarry long enough on the same path that leaves us feeling overcommitted, overwhelmed and over-connected, and as a result, robs us of rest.
I rate this book 5 out of 5 stars.
About Vicki Courtney
Vicki Courtney is a speaker and the best-selling author of numerous books and Bible studies including, Rest Assured, Move On, Ever After, 5 Conversations You Must Have With Your Daughter, and 5 Conversations You Must Have With Your Son. She is the recipient of a Mom’s Choice award and a two-time ECPA Christian Book Award winner.
Known and respected as a “mom in the trenches,” Vicki has shared her youth culture wisdom on CNN, FOX News, and Focus on the Family, and blogs each week at VirtueAlert.com. She lives with her husband and their three children in Austin, Texas.
